Jasper Ridge Partners L.P. Has $4.57 Million Stake in Robinhood Markets, Inc. (NASDAQ:HOOD)

Robinhood Markets logo with Finance background

Jasper Ridge Partners L.P. lessened its holdings in shares of Robinhood Markets, Inc. (NASDAQ:HOOD - Free Report) by 32.0%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 122,631 shares of the company's stock after selling 57,625 shares during the quarter. Jasper Ridge Partners L.P.'s holdings in Robinhood Markets were worth $4,569,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Several other hedge funds also recently modified their holdings of HOOD. Franklin Resources Inc. purchased a new stake in Robinhood Markets in the 3rd quarter worth approximately $6,321,000. Wedmont Private Capital bought a new position in shares of Robinhood Markets in the fourth quarter worth approximately $386,000. Friedenthal Financial bought a new stake in shares of Robinhood Markets in the 4th quarter worth about $764,000. Pallas Capital Advisors LLC raised its position in Robinhood Markets by 51.3% in the 4th quarter. Pallas Capital Advisors LLC now owns 31,657 shares of the company's stock worth $1,180,000 after purchasing an additional 10,727 shares during the period. Finally, AdvisorNet Financial Inc increased its holdings in Robinhood Markets by 34.6% during the fourth quarter. AdvisorNet Financial Inc now owns 3,372 shares of the company's stock valued at $126,000 after buying an additional 867 shares during the period. Institutional investors own 93.27% of the company's stock.

Insider Buying and Selling at Robinhood Markets

In related news, CEO Vladimir Tenev sold 750,000 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ction dated Tuesday, April 1st. The stock was sold at an average price of $41.96, for a total transaction of $31,470,000.00.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is available at this link. Also, CTO Jeffrey Tsvi Pinner sold 5,853 shares of the business's stock in a transaction on Wednesday, March 5th. The shares were sold at an average price of $46.81, for a total value of $273,978.93.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ief technology officer now owns 17,559 shares of the company's stock, valued at $821,936.79. This trade represents a 25.00%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Over the last 90 days, insiders sold 1,840,014 shares of company stock worth $83,494,057. 14.47% of the stock is currently owned by insiders.

Robinhood Markets (NASDAQ:HOOD -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, April 30th. The company reported $0.37 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.41 by ($0.04). The firm had revenue of $927.00 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$917.12 million. Robinhood Markets had a return on equity of 13.53% and a net margin of 47.81%. The company's revenue for the quarter was up 50.0%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the company earned $0.18 EPS. As a group, analysts predict that Robinhood Markets, Inc. will post 1.35 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Robinhood Markets Company Profile

(Free Report)

Robinhood Markets, Inc operates financial services platform in the United States. Its platform allows users to invest in stocks, exchange-traded funds (ETFs), American depository receipts, options, gold, and cryptocurrencies. The company offers fractional trading, recurring investments, fully-paid securities lending, access to investing on margin, cash sweep, instant withdrawals, retirement program, around-the-clock trading, and initial public offerings participation services.
